OXPS fájlok PDF formátumba konvertálása a GroupDocs.Conversion for .NET használatával
Bevezetés
Az XPS fájlok univerzálisan elfogadott formátumba, például PDF-be konvertálása elengedhetetlen mind a szakmai, mind a személyes környezetben. Ez az útmutató végigvezeti Önt a használatán. GroupDocs.Conversion .NET-hez az OXPS fájlok zökkenőmentes PDF formátumba konvertálásához.
- Amit tanulni fogsz:
- Környezet beállítása a GroupDocs.Conversion segítségével.
- Lépésről lépésre útmutató az OXPS fájlok PDF formátumba konvertálásához.
- Főbb konfigurációs lehetőségek és ajánlott eljárások a teljesítményoptimalizáláshoz.
Kezdjük azzal, hogy megbizonyosodunk arról, hogy rendelkezel a szükséges előfeltételekkel!
Előfeltételek
Mielőtt elkezdenénk, győződjünk meg róla, hogy rendelkezünk a következőkkel:
- Kötelező könyvtárakGroupDocs.Conversion a .NET 25.3.0 verziójához.
- Környezet beállításaC# kód futtatására alkalmas fejlesztői környezet, például a Visual Studio.
- Ismereti előfeltételekC# programozás alapjainak ismerete és a .NET fájlkezelésének ismerete.
Miután ezeket az előfeltételeket teljesítettük, térjünk át a GroupDocs.Conversion for .NET beállítására.
A GroupDocs.Conversion beállítása .NET-hez
A GroupDocs.Conversion használatához telepítse a NuGet Package Manageren vagy a .NET CLI-n keresztül:
NuGet csomagkezelő konzol
Install-Package GroupDocs.Conversion -Version 25.3.0
.NET parancssori felület
dotnet add package GroupDocs.Conversion --version 25.3.0
Licencbeszerzés
A GroupDocs különböző licencelési lehetőségeket kínál, beleértve az ingyenes próbaverziót tesztelési célokra és az ideiglenes licenceket a kiterjesztett értékeléshez:
- Ingyenes próbaverzió: Töltse le a legújabb verziót innen: itt.
- Ideiglenes engedély: Szerezzen be egy ideiglenes licencet a teljes funkciók korlátozás nélküli felfedezéséhez itt.
- VásárlásHosszú távú használat esetén érdemes megfontolni egy licenc megvásárlását. itt.
Alapvető inicializálás és beállítás
Így inicializálhatod a GroupDocs.Conversion függvényt a C# projektedben:
using System;
using GroupDocs.Conversion;
class Program
{
static void Main()
{
// Inicializálja a Converter objektumot egy bemeneti OXPS fájlútvonallal
using (var converter = new Converter("YOUR_DOCUMENT_DIRECTORY\\sample.oxps"))
{
Console.WriteLine("Converter initialized successfully.");
}
}
}
Megvalósítási útmutató
Bontsuk le a konverziós folyamatot kezelhető lépésekre.
1. lépés: Kimeneti könyvtár és fájlnév meghatározása
Kezd azzal, hogy megadod, hová mentsd a konvertált PDF fájlt:
string outputFolder = Path.Combine(@"YOUR_OUTPUT_DIRECTORY");
string outputFile = Path.Combine(outputFolder, "oxps-converted-to.pdf");
2. lépés: Töltse be a forrás OXPS fájlt
Töltsd be a forrásfájlt a GroupDocs.Conversion segítségével Converter
osztály. Ez kezeli a kezdeti beállításokat, és előkészíti a dokumentumot a konvertálásra.
using (var converter = new Converter(@"YOUR_DOCUMENT_DIRECTORY\sample.oxps"))
{
Console.WriteLine("Source OXPS file loaded.");
}
3. lépés: Konverziós beállítások megadása
PDF-specifikus beállítások konfigurálása a következővel: PdfConvertOptions
Ez lehetővé teszi a kimeneti formátumra vonatkozó beállítások megadását.
var options = new PdfConvertOptions();
Console.WriteLine("PDF conversion options set.");
4. lépés: A fájl konvertálása és mentése
Végül használd a Convert
a konvertálás végrehajtásának és a PDF fájl mentésének módja:
converter.Convert(outputFile, options);
Console.WriteLine("Conversion completed successfully!");
Gyakorlati alkalmazások
A GroupDocs.Conversion különféle .NET rendszerekbe integrálható változatos alkalmazásokhoz:
- Dokumentumkezelő rendszerek: Automatizálja a felhasználó által feltöltött dokumentumok szabványos formátumokba konvertálását.
- Kiadói platformok: Cikkek konvertálása OXPS formátumból PDF formátumba digitális könyvtárakban való terjesztés céljából.
- Vállalati szoftvermegoldásokSzabványosítsa a dokumentummunkafolyamatokat a különböző fájltípusok PDF formátumba konvertálásával.
Teljesítménybeli szempontok
A GroupDocs.Conversion használatakor a zökkenőmentes teljesítmény biztosítása érdekében:
- Figyelemmel kíséri az erőforrás-felhasználást és optimalizálja a memóriakezelést, különösen nagy fájlok feldolgozásakor.
- Használjon aszinkron programozási technikákat, ahol lehetséges, az alkalmazások válaszidejének javítása érdekében.
- A hatékony alkalmazásteljesítmény fenntartása érdekében kövesse a .NET fejlesztés ajánlott gyakorlatait.
Következtetés
Most már elsajátítottad az OXPS fájlok PDF-be konvertálásának képességét a GroupDocs.Conversion for .NET segítségével! A GroupDocs által kínált lehetőségek további felfedezéséhez érdemes lehet további fájlkonvertálási funkciókat is megvizsgálni, vagy további funkciókat integrálni.
Következő lépésekKísérletezz különböző dokumentumtípusokkal, és merülj el mélyebben az API képességeiben. Készen állsz a kipróbálásra? Kezdd el implementálni ezeket a konverziókat a következő projektedben!
GYIK szekció
- Konvertálhatok egyszerre több OXPS fájlt?
- Igen, kötegelt feldolgozást is végezhet fájlgyűjteményeken keresztüli iterációval.
- Milyen formátumok támogatottak az átalakításhoz?
- A GroupDocs.Conversion számos dokumentum- és képformátumot támogat.
- Van-e korlátozás a konvertálható fájlok méretére?
- Bár nincs explicit korlát beállítva, a teljesítmény nagyobb fájlok esetén változhat.
- Hogyan kezeljem a konvertálás során fellépő hibákat?
- Implementálj try-catch blokkokat a konverziós logikád köré a hibakezelés érdekében.
- Testreszabhatom a PDF kimeneti beállításait?
- Feltétlenül! Fedezd fel!
PdfConvertOptions
a PDF-kimenetek testreszabásához.
- Feltétlenül! Fedezd fel!